The Role
Strategic Advisers Inc. (SAI) Advisor Oversight Team is responsible for managing SAI's Sub-Adviser and Separately Managed Account Programs. We provide risk and oversight guidance for SAI's product initiatives. The Team supports SAI's and our distribution channel's strategic growth through sub-advised funds and separately managed account offerings.
- Lead initial due diligence efforts for third party providers
- Develop Board reporting in support of initial candidate presentations, quarterly reporting, and annual contract renewals
- Relationship management for third party providers through ongoing engagement
- Manage implementation activities with internal and external partners
- Participate and contribute to governance forums related to due diligence efforts
- Review and enhance breadth of oversight program, including existing policies and controls

The Team
The Strategic Advisers Advisor Oversight team performs is seeking a motivated individual to support the initial due diligence, ongoing oversight, and implementation for third party providers. In this role the individual will be responsible for providing support to our investment team and safeguarding Fidelity's reputation for our Board of Trustees. The individual will be responsible for maintaining relationships within SAI, internal cross company business partners, and external partners at both the management and working team levels. Oversight activities include quarterly reviews, annual contract renewals and brokerage reporting.
